Course Description
Online Education Bachelor of Technology in Computer Science and Engineering
A Bachelor of Technology in Computer Science & Engineering is a 4-year undergraduate program that focuses on the design, development, and maintenance of computer software and hardware. The program covers a broad range of topics in computer science, including programming, algorithms, data structures, computer organization, computer networks, database systems, operating systems, and software engineering.Distance learning programs in BTech Computer Science Engineering offer the same curriculum as on-campus programs, but with the flexibility of studying from home or other remote locations. Students can access course materials, lectures, and assignments online and interact with professors and classmates through email, chat, or video conferencing.However, it’s important to note that pursuing a distance BTech degree requires a high level of self-discipline and motivation, as students are largely responsible for managing their own learning and keeping up with coursework. Additionally, some employers may prefer candidates with on-campus degrees or may require certain certifications or hands-on experience in addition to a BTech degree.Overall, a distance BTech in Computer Science Engineering can be a great option for those who are motivated, self-directed learners and are looking to advance their careers in the field of computer science.

Eligibility Criteria for the Enrollment of Bachelor of Technology in Computer Science & Engineering Distance Education
- Educational Qualifications: Applicants must have completed their 10+2 or equivalent examination from a recognized board or institution with Mathematics, Physics, and Chemistry as compulsory subjects.
- Minimum Percentage: The minimum percentage required for admission may vary depending on the institution, but generally, candidates must have scored at least 50% marks in aggregate in their 10+2 or equivalent examination.
- Age Limit: There is no upper age limit for admission to a BTech in Computer Science Engineering distance education program, but candidates must have completed 17 years of age on or before the commencement of the course.
- Entrance Exams: Some institutions may require candidates to take entrance exams like JEE Main, BITSAT, or state-level entrance exams to qualify for admission. However, many institutions offer direct admission based on merit, i.e., the candidate’s performance in their 10+2 or equivalent examination.
- Work Experience: Some institutions may also require candidates to have relevant work experience in the field of computer science or related areas.

Further Studies After Bachelor of Technology in Computer Science & Engineering Distance Education
- MTech in Computer Science Engineering: Pursuing a Master’s degree in Computer Science Engineering can help you deepen your knowledge and gain advanced skills in the field. MTech programs typically focus on advanced topics such as data science, machine learning, artificial intelligence, and advanced software engineering.
- MBA in Information Technology: If you are interested in combining your technical skills with business management skills, you can consider pursuing an MBA in Information Technology. This program will equip you with skills in management, leadership, and strategic planning, as well as knowledge of the latest trends and technologies in the field of information technology.
- PhD in Computer Science Engineering: If you are interested in pursuing a career in research and development, you can consider pursuing a Ph.D. in Computer Science Engineering. This program will equip you with advanced research skills and in-depth knowledge of a specific area of computer science.
- Certification courses: There are several certification courses that you can consider after completing your BTech in Computer Science Engineering. These courses will help you gain specific skills and knowledge in areas such as cybersecurity, network administration, programming languages, and software development.
